Manual versus automated γ-H2AX foci analysis across five European laboratories: can this assay be used for rapid biodosimetry in a large scale radiation accident?
Kai Rothkamm,Stephen Barnard,Elizabeth A. Ainsbury,Jenna Al-hafidh,Joan Francesc Barquinero,Carita Lindholm,Jayne Moquet,Marjo Perälä,Sandrine Roch-Lefèvre,Harry Scherthan,Hubert Thierens,Anne Vral,Veerle Vandersickel +12 more
TL;DR: It is concluded that the γ-H2AX assay may be useful for rapid triage following a recent acute radiation exposure and the potentially higher speed and convenience of automated relative to manual foci scoring needs to be balanced against its compromised accuracy and inability to detect partial body exposures.

Translocation yields in peripheral blood lymphocytes from control populations
Caroline A. Whitehouse,Alan Edwards,Tawn Ej,G. Stephan,Ursula Oestreicher,Jayne Moquet,David Lloyd,Laurence Roy,P. Voisin,Carita Lindholm,Joan Francesc Barquinero,Leonardo Barrios,M. R. Caballín,Firouz Darroudi,Fomina J +14 more
TL;DR: There is a strong variation of translocation yield with age but no variation was detectable with gender or smoking habits, and a generic age-dependent control level can be assumed for retrospective biological dosimetry purposes.
